Angul: In a tragic incident, a 35-year-old woman was trampled by a wild elephant in Saharagoda SunaBhuin village under Bantala Block in Angul district on Wednesday morning.
The deceased woman has been identified as Jali Behera (35), a native of the same village as mentioned above.
As per reports, the incident took place when Jali went to fetch water from a nearby tube well. The tusker, attacked her and she died on the spot.
On being informed, the villagers reached the spot and found her lying in a pool of blood.
Meanwhile, the irate villagers have staged a protest and has demanded safety measures from the forest department.
